Output cc8b88e7f74b9124a70ae173202856470495a39d0140c946bc10b91468debd8a:2

value
2629800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b44572d83f652f9d12e828c69bdfb7363bdb9d84 OP_EQUALVERIFY OP_CHECKSIG
address
DMaHNAMW79SQurQZJAKegQmXAQVAhfjcGz
transaction
cc8b88e7f74b9124a70ae173202856470495a39d0140c946bc10b91468debd8a